ChilledWindows.exe is a well-known "joke virus" or prank program originally created for Windows. It is designed to simulate a catastrophic system failure—often involving flashing lights, rotating screen effects, and a fake Blue Screen of Death (BSOD)—all synchronized to upbeat music. While it is generally considered harmless to the computer's actual hardware and data, it is frequently flagged by antivirus software as a threat due to its intrusive behavior. The file ChilledWindows.exe is a well-known "joke virus" or prank program originally created for Windows PCs, not a native Android application. While some users search for an Android download, the program is actually a simulation that mimics a system crash or virus infection through visual effects. What is ChilledWindows.exe?
A "Joke Virus": It is designed to scare users by simulating a desktop inversion, flashing screens, and fake Blue Screen of Death (BSOD) errors.
Non-Destructive Origin: In its original form, it typically does not damage system files, though it has been flagged as malware by some security tools due to its behavior.
Visual Prank: It often works by taking a screenshot of the desktop and playing a video over it to make the user think their computer is malfunctioning. Can it run on Android?
Because it is a .exe file, it cannot run natively on Android, which uses .apk files. To run such a file on an Android device, a user would need specialized emulation software:
Winlator: A popular tool mentioned by Winlator tutorials for running Windows applications on Android.
Exagear: Another common emulator used to run PC software on mobile devices.
Virtual Machines: Apps like Limbo or Bochs can boot older versions of Windows on Android to execute such files. Security Risks and Warnings

ChilledWindows.exe is primarily known as a "joke virus" or "jokeware" rather than a standard Android application. While originally designed for Windows, it has gained internet fame through simulator remixes on platforms like Scratch and TurboWarp , making it accessible on mobile browsers. Review: ChilledWindows.exe (Mockup/Joke Edition)
Experience & Visuals: The "program" works by creating a simulated desktop experience that eventually "glitches." It often begins by showing a blue background and then starts flashing or rotating the screen to mimic a catastrophic system failure.
The "Payload": The highlight is a sequence of fake errors and Blue Screen of Death (BSOD) mockups, often synced to music for dramatic or comedic effect.
Security Risk: While the original version is a harmless prank that doesn't actually damage system files, it has been flagged as malware by many security suites because its behavior—screenshotting the desktop and triggering full-screen fake errors—resembles malicious activity.
Android Accessibility: To run the actual .exe file on Android, users typically require emulators like Winlator or ExaGear . However, most Android users "play" Chilled Windows through web-based simulators or YouTube videos to avoid the risk of downloading suspicious executable files.
